WebOur Grandmothers Lyrics She lay, skin down in the moist dirt, The canebrake rustling With the whispers of leaves, and Loud longing of hounds and The ransack of hunters … WebI Shall Not Be Moved is author and poet Maya Angelou's fifth collection of poetry, published by Random House in 1990. Angelou had written four autobiographies and published four other volumes of poetry up to that point. Angelou considered herself a poet and a playwright and her poetry has also been successful, but she is best known for her seven …
